Noh Young-dae, who shocked the nation in 2012 with a rape case and a daring police station escape, has completed his 13-year sentence and returned to society.
📌 Key Points
News of Noh choosing Chuncheon as his residence has caused significant anxiety among locals, leading to urgent demands for safety measures.
💡 Why It Matters
Police have established guard posts and increased patrol personnel for 24-hour surveillance. Local authorities are working to ensure community safety.
📚 Glossary
전자발찌 (Jeonja-baljji)An electronic ankle bracelet used to track the real-time location of sex offenders to prevent reoffending.
보호관찰 (Boho-gwanchal)A system of supervising released offenders to help them reintegrate into society and prevent recidivism.
